While setting up the tools area in windows defender, the "understanding real
time protection" link errors and I can't go look at what this means to help
me decide what is going on in the 'real time protection' settings.
Do I need all of them checked?
some of them?
None of them?
 
R

robinb

you should have them all checked unless you are having a problem with WD.
You can view any errors that WD makes in the Event Viewer.
You can find Event Viewer in Control Panel Administrative Tools in both
Vista and XP. In Vista it is easier to put Control Panel in Classic View to
find the Event Viewer.
